Тесты онлайн, бесплатный конструктор тестов. Психологические тестирования, тесты на проверку знаний.

Список вопросов базы знаний

Алгоритмические языки и программирование

Вопрос id:669756
При вызове процедуры фактические параметры подставляются на место формальных
?) нет
?) да
Вопрос id:669757
Присваиваемые процедуры и функции могут быть объявлены внутри других процедур
?) нет
?) да
Вопрос id:669758
Процедура - особым образом оформленный фрагмент программы, имеющий собственное имя
?) да
?) нет
Вопрос id:669759
Процедура не может обращаться к самой себе
?) верно
?) неверно
Вопрос id:669760
Стандартной директивой не является
?) near
?) far
?) real
?) forward
Вопрос id:669761
Стандартные директивы уточняют действия компилятора
?) нет
?) да
Вопрос id:669762
Текст программы транслируется последовательно снизу вверх
?) нет
?) да
Вопрос id:669763
У всех параметров подпрограмм один и тот же способ передачи
?) нет
?) да
Вопрос id:669764
Числа Фибоначчи - последовательность чисел, в которой первое и второе число равно единице, а каждое следующее - сумме двух предыдущих
?) да
?) нет
Вопрос id:669765
В подпрограмме список формальных параметров необязателен и может отсутствовать
?) неверно
?) верно
Вопрос id:669766
В программе можно несколько раз обратиться к одной и той же процедуре
?) нет
?) да
Вопрос id:669767
В процедуре используется параметр-константа, которая
?) передает неизменяемое значением, перед именем слово CONST
?) указывается в заголовке программы и перед ее именем ставятся слова TIP:CONST
?) передает значение и имеет перед именем ее слово Var
?) может быть числом целого или вещественного типа
Вопрос id:669768
В списке формальных параметров процедуры параметры-значения используются для передачи в процедуру входных данных
?) верно
?) неверно
Вопрос id:669769
Возвращаемое значение функции может иметь тип строковый
?) да
?) нет
Вопрос id:669770
Вызов - обращение к:
?) стандартному модулю;
?) подпрограмме и выполнению операторов;
?) модулю, созданному программистом
?) стандартной функции и ее выполнение;
Вопрос id:669771
Вызов функции принципиально не отличается от вызова процедуры, достаточно использовать ее имя в выражении
?) ложно
?) истинно
Вопрос id:669772
Выйти из функции можно, используя оператор GO TO
?) неверно
?) верно
Вопрос id:669773
Выход из подпрограммы-функции происходит по команде GOTO<метка>, если метка стоит за пределами подпрограммы
?) нет
?) да
Вопрос id:669774
Действие глобальных переменных распространяется на функции, имеющиеся в программе, если они входят в список фактических параметров
?) истинно
?) ложно
Вопрос id:669775
Друг в друга можно вложить процедуры и функции
?) да
?) нет
Вопрос id:669776
Если в заголовке описания процедуры имеется параметр-переменная, то при вызове процедуры на ее место можно подставить константу
?) нет
?) да
Вопрос id:669777
Заголовок процедуры PROCEDURE PRIM_PROC1 (A1:Real;BZ:Real;C:Integer;Var C:Real); имеет ошибки
?) да
?) нет
Вопрос id:669778
Заголовок процедуры имеет вид: PROCEDURE PRIMER_SUMMA (I,J,K:Real;Var X,Y:Real); Это корректный вызов данной процедуры: PRIMER SUMMA (44,30,B5,X0,10)
?) да
?) нет
Вопрос id:669779
Заголовок функции FUNCTION F1(N,M,L:INTEGER;S:REAL;K:INTEGER):STRING: не имеет ошибок
?) верно
?) неверно
Вопрос id:669780
Заголовок функции по сравнению с процедурой имеет дополнительный параметр входных значений переменных
?) ложно
?) истинно
Вопрос id:669781
Локальные переменные действуют только внутри процедуры
?) верно
?) неверно
Вопрос id:669782
Наиболее верно утверждение, что рекурсия
?) преимущество языка Паскаль
?) имеется в языках программирования низкого уровня
?) означает исключительно математическое понятие
?) преимущество языка Турбо Паскаль
Вопрос id:669783
Наибольший эффект при использовании параметра-константы достигается тогда, когда в процедуру передаются
?) для длинных переменных целого типа (LongInt), которые занимают весь стек
?) переменных вещественного типа, поскольку этот тип занимает значительное место в памяти
?) массивы и записи, т. к. они занимают значительную часть стека
?) переменные целого типа, т. к. упрощается передача значений
Вопрос id:669784
Наибольший эффект при использовании параметра-константы достигается тогда, когда в процедуру передаются
?) переменные целого типа, т. к. упрощается передача значений
?) переменные вещественного типа, поскольку этот тип занимает значительное место в памяти
?) массивы и записи, т. к. они занимают значительную часть стека
?) длинные переменные целого типа (LongInt), которые занимают весь стек
Вопрос id:669785
Опережающее описание подпрограмм используется тогда, когда необходимо описать:
?) две подпрограммы, которые взаимно вызывают друг друга;
?) функцию, использующую поочередный вызов двух частей процедур
?) две и более подпрограммы, вложенные друг в друга;
?) последовательно более двух различных подпрограмм, каждая из которых имеет свой заголовок;
Вопрос id:669786
Отличие подпрограммы-функции от подпрограммы-процедуры в том, что в теле функции должен быть оператор присваивания формальной переменной значений вычисленного результата
?) верно
?) неверно
Вопрос id:669787
Параметр-константу целесообразно использовать, если в подпрограмму следует передать
?) переменную, которую программа не должна менять
?) целого типа
?) строковаую переменную
?) значение массива
Вопрос id:669788
Параметр-константу целесообразно использовать, если в подпрограмму следует передать
?) значение массива
?) строковая переменная
?) целого типа
?) переменную, которую программа не должна менять
Вопрос id:669789
Параметры-переменные используются в списке формальных параметров для описания типа массивов
?) истинно
?) ложно
Вопрос id:669790
Подпрограмма - группа операторов, объединенных операторными скобками
?) нет
?) да
Вопрос id:669791
При вызове процедуры на место параметра-значения можно подставить непосредственное значение
?) нет
?) да
Вопрос id:669792
При использовании функции следует учитывать, что нельзя в качестве результата работы функции использовать структурированный тип
?) истинно
?) ложно
Вопрос id:669793
Процедура должна иметь собственное имя
?) нет
?) да
Вопрос id:669794
Процедура может иметь в своем составе другую процедуру
?) неверно
?) верно
Вопрос id:669795
Процедура-функция:
?) подпрограмма-функция, имеющая в заголовке параметры-переменные;
?) стандартная функция (Sin(x), Cos(x) и др.);
?) такая процедура, имени которой после выполнения присваивается результат;
?) функция, объявленная после слова USES
Вопрос id:669796
Процедуры могут использовать глобальные переменные
?) истинно
?) ложно
Вопрос id:669797
Функция может иметь в своем составе процедуры
?) да
?) нет
Вопрос id:669798
Функция может обратиться к самой себе
?) да
?) нет
Вопрос id:669799
A * B - множество из элементов A и B
?) нет
?) да
Вопрос id:669800
A - B - множество элементов B, не входящих в A
?) нет
?) да
Вопрос id:669801
X := E допустимо только тогда, когда все элементы множественного выражения E относятся к базовому типу X
?) да
?) нет
Вопрос id:669802
[4.0, 5.0] - верная запись конструктора множеств
?) да
?) нет
Вопрос id:669803
Базовый тип - любой порядковый тип
?) да
?) нет
Вопрос id:669804
В процедуре Insert первым параметром указывается имя исходной строки
?) да
?) нет
Вопрос id:669805
Вариантные записи прeдназначены для одновременного сохранения различных структур данных
?) нет
?) да
Copyright testserver.pro 2013-2024